DUNCAN, Okla. (July 12, 2021) – Oklahoma Christian golfer
Alyssa Wilson qualified 20th on Monday in the seeding round for the Women's Oklahoma Golf Association State Amateur Championship at The Territory Golf and Country Club.
Wilson, a rising sophomore from Yukon, posted a 12-over-par 84, recording a birdie on the par-3 No. 14 on the 6,044-yard course. She qualified to continue playing in the event as part of the President's flight, the second-highest level.
The 11 players in the President's flight will continue play on Tuesday. Wilson will receive a first-round bye before playing Chrissy Bagwell of Edmond in an afternoon quarterfinal match. The semifinals are set to be played Wednesday, with the title match on Thursday.
Wilson played in four tournaments for OC during the 2020-21 season, recording a scoring average of 80.22 over nine rounds. She tied for seventh in the West Texas A&M Fall Invitational in Amarillo, Texas, in October, which was her first collegiate top-10 finish.
